    It depends whether you rush or take it moderately slow. Its not really possible to make the AI rush resistant without making them overpowering if they should go to war with you early on.

    That said, alliances hold depending on whether you are a trusted ally and your relations with that faction. If both your reputations are quite high and you have good relations (which normally is the case with marriage alliances), the chances of backstab are very low, especially if they are engaged in another war. This is to prevent the AI from overstretching itself and spelling out its own doom.
